Biography

US Black Heritage Project
Bell (Barnes) Frazier is a part of US Black heritage.

Bell Barnes was born around 1889 in Henning, Lauderdale County, Tennessee. Over the years, she lived in various locations, reflecting a life of movement and adaptation.

By 1910, Bell lived in Texas Township, Lee County, Arkansas. A decade later, in 1920, she had moved back to Civil District 5, Lauderdale County, Tennessee. By 1930, she was living in Lucas Township, Crittenden County, Arkansas, indicating a return to her previous residence or a similar area.

By 1940, Bell had relocated to Detroit, Wayne County, Michigan, where she continued to live in 1950 as well. In Detroit, she worked as a housekeeper for a private family, showcasing her dedication to providing service and support to others throughout her life. Bell's journey spanned from the rural regions of Tennessee and Arkansas to the urban environment of Detroit, reflecting the changes and experiences of her times.
